Old Town Hall, Burslem, Stoke-on-Trent, March 2021

This baroque-style “Old Town Hall” was built between 1854 and 1857. This is the portico ate west end of the building, adorned with Corinthian columns and caryatids, plus a clock tower with a gilded Angela the top. Since its days at Town Hall, it has served as public library, host to a pottery heritage centre and is now home to a Sixth Form Academy.
